OSINT Methodology
OpSec
Create a Sock Puppet
- Fake account that cannot be linked to you
- Build a posting history (post stuff, etc.)

- Use separate browser profiles or isolation tools (e.g., Firefox Multi‑Account Containers) for any sock‑puppet activity.
- Acquire disposable VoIP/SMS numbers (e.g., Burner, Silent Link) to satisfy platform verification without exposing real phone numbers.
- Audit every browser extension before installation; supply‑chain attacks on popular add‑ons have targeted investigators since 2024.
- Use dedicated browser profiles/containers per case and persona; avoid logging into personal accounts.
- Prefer hardware‑backed passkeys for critical accounts; store recovery codes offline.
- Maintain a minimal chain‑of‑custody: timestamp actions, hash key artifacts, and record tool versions per case.
